Fungsi CertEnumCTLContextProperties (wincrypt.h)

Fungsi CertEnumCTLContextProperties mengambil properti yang diperluas pertama atau berikutnya yang terkait dengan konteks daftar kepercayaan sertifikat (CTL). Digunakan dalam perulangan, fungsi ini dapat mengambil secara berurutan semua properti yang diperluas yang terkait dengan konteks CTL.

Sintaks

DWORD CertEnumCTLContextProperties(
  [in] PCCTL_CONTEXT pCtlContext,
  [in] DWORD         dwPropId
);

Parameter

[in] pCtlContext

Penunjuk ke struktur CTL_CONTEXT .

[in] dwPropId

Nomor properti properti terakhir yang dijumlahkan. Untuk mendapatkan properti pertama, dwPropId adalah nol. Untuk mengambil properti berikutnya, dwPropId diatur ke nomor properti yang dikembalikan oleh panggilan terakhir ke fungsi. Untuk menghitung semua properti, panggilan fungsi berlanjut hingga fungsi mengembalikan nol.

Aplikasi dapat memanggil CertGetCTLContextProperty dengan dwPropId yang dikembalikan oleh fungsi ini untuk mengambil data properti tersebut.

Mengembalikan nilai

Nilai yang dikembalikan adalah nilai DWORD yang mengidentifikasi properti konteks CTL. Nilai DWORD yang dikembalikan oleh satu panggilan fungsi dapat disediakan sebagai dwPropId dalam panggilan berikutnya ke fungsi. Jika tidak ada lagi properti yang akan dijumlahkan atau jika fungsi gagal, nol akan dikembalikan.

Persyaratan

   
Klien minimum yang didukung Windows XP [aplikasi desktop | Aplikasi UWP]
Server minimum yang didukung Windows Server 2003 [aplikasi desktop | Aplikasi UWP]
Target Platform Windows
Header wincrypt.h
Pustaka Crypt32.lib
DLL Crypt32.dll

Lihat juga

CertGetCTLContextProperty

Fungsi Properti yang Diperluas